About The Position

The Quality Assurance Technician will assist Quality Engineers in completing validation and PPAP tasks, including First Article Inspection (FAI), performance or functional testing, and report writing. This role involves performing dimensional layouts using hand-measurement tools and CMM, conducting print reviews for new or revised products, and tabulating sample data using statistical programs. The technician will also assist in compiling technical reports, creating and updating process flow diagrams, PFMEA, and control plans, collecting and analyzing product data, supporting corrective action activities, and providing back-up support for Receiving and Final Inspection when required.
